    A bit of trivia for you Eddie. Bangkok Hospital Group is the largest private hospital chain in Thailand, and located in most major Thai cities and overseas. Also, 'Hua' means 'head' in English, and 'Hin' means 'stone', but the adjective usually follows the noun in Thai, so it would mean 'stone head', not 'headstone'. It was named after the rocks at the north end of the beach. My Thai friend also says 'Hua' is pronounced 'Who-a' .There you go! Cheers! Ha ha.

    The Bangkok Hospital group is the largest private hospital group in Thailand, with 40+ hospitals all over Thailand but was originally just one hospital in 1972 in Bangkok, hence the name.
